I don't know what any of that means, but thank you!We didn't make any deliberate changes relative to site performance. We routinely apply OS and control panel updates to the web and database servers, which can have an impact. That happened twice this week, so I can't rule out server-side related difference, For the vast majority of visitors, the site's performance was good before any such updates.
Service worker js script likely isn't the issue, as that's part of the forum application stack and hasn't changed.
It could also be something the data center did, without regard to ODT: Perhaps nullify a bad route that other data center residents were complaining about. That's where I'd place my bet.
We have numerous monitors watching the site's uptime and performance. Since the last round of major forum updates and changes (in 2022), the performance has been very consistent. We have the stack tuned to the point where a high percentage of visitors have a good performance experience, including during higher traffic periods.
